US is a premium unisex skincare brand, designed and built end to end as a concept. The landing page leads with a before/after drag slider in the hero, so the first thing a visitor does is pull a handle across a face and watch the skin clear. The whole page is built in React and TypeScript, fully responsive, and deployed on Vercel.
Most skincare sites bury their proof: you scroll past hero copy, past ingredient claims, past the founder story, and only near the bottom do you reach the before/after photos that actually sell the product. I wanted to invert that. The result, the moment you land, should be in your hands.
So the core idea became a draggable before/after reveal in the hero. No autoplay, no carousel of testimonials to wait through. You grab the handle, you drag, you see the change. Everything else on the page, the concern grid, the bestsellers, the team, the testimonials, was built to support that one decision.
Process
Every decision on the page serves one goal: make a visitor believe the product works before they have read a single line of copy.
That is why the hero leads with a slider you drag yourself. I could have shown a before/after as two static photos, or auto-played a wipe. Neither asks anything of you. Making someone physically pull the handle across a face changes the psychology. You control the reveal, so you trust the reveal. The transformation happens in your hand, at your pace, and that small act of participation does more for belief than any claim I could write.
From there the whole page is built as a single argument. The concern grid meets visitors at their actual problem, in their own words, before any product is mentioned. Bestsellers reveal a clinical-validation card on hover, so proof sits one gesture away from every product. The team section puts real faces and credentials behind the brand. Testimonials close the loop with more before-and-afters. Problem, proof, people, proof again. By the time you reach the footer, you have been given every reason to believe.
Under all of it is a hand-built React and TypeScript front end, fully responsive from desktop down to mobile and shipped on Vercel. No template, no page builder. The polish you feel is coded, not assembled.
